Transaction ea0821ebfe2eb24ed4a54f8cd5922cb88be0c89527d8b09f66d32f7b2e4a2340

1 Input
2 Outputs
  • ea0821ebfe2eb24ed4a54f8cd5922cb88be0c89527d8b09f66d32f7b2e4a2340:0
  • value  40000000
    address  18DdfwVYN16brpxqPmDNRhPGPGLdCKP28i
  • ea0821ebfe2eb24ed4a54f8cd5922cb88be0c89527d8b09f66d32f7b2e4a2340:1
  • value  558686371
    address  1MukUiEf2juCbB2HeR4ihyau5CdCgBzAN2